Join us as we grow our way into a future that reimagines what it means to deliver meaningful benefits support and service.Job DescriptionWhat You’ll Do:Reporting to the Group Life and Disability Claims - Quality Assurance Team Manager you’ll beresponsible for conducting comprehensive quality assurance reviews for Group Life and Disability Claims (GL&DC) and LTD Services. This includes evaluating technical and system processes, contractual case management, and call observations. These reviews will be performed in alignment with the department's established contractual and administrative policies. The role also involves clearly communicating the results of these reviews to GL&DC staff, both verbally and in writing. Additionally, the Disability Specialist will participate as a member of the Appeal Committee as needed.The core parts of your role will be to:Works as a member of the Group Life and Disability Claims Quality Assurance team to conduct regular quality assurance audits of GL&DC staff as assigned in an efficient manner.Completes quality assurance reviews and provides results of technical, case management and call observation audits in accordance with contractual and administrative policies established within the GL&DC department.Deliver timely quality assurance reviews.Effectively communicates quality assurance results and maintains confidentiality related to an individual’s audit results.Liaises with the training team to identify trends, best practices, and training needs, ensuring training and development initiatives are aligned with audit findings and organizational objectives.Works closely with the GL&DC management team related to an individual’s results or to change the audit review focus as needed to meet the changing requirements of GL&DC business needs.Acts as a senior resource to GL&DC claims employees and managers. This may include providing input on complex claim situations, contractual interpretation and assigned projects.Maintains technical knowledge by attending educational workshops, reviewing publications.Supports change within GL&DC and works effectively in a team environment and contributes to overall team goals and workload management.The Disability Specialist will intermittently represent the claims business area as part of the Appeal Committee where they will be required to review appeal claims and discuss the case with other appeal committee members to render a final appeal decision.Performs other duties with competence, as assigned.QualificationsLet’s Talk About You:This is the unique blend of skills and experience we would love to see in an ideal candidate:Qualifications:A university degree or college diploma in a related subject.A minimum of five years’ experience in long-term disability claims adjudication in the insurance field.Strong knowledge related to long term disability claims management and payments, insurance principles and practices, industry standards, and legal and contractual obligations.Exceptional communication skills and the demonstrated ability to deal effectively with all levels of internal and external stakeholders.Superior time management and organizational skills to manage competing priorities, including project management skills.Intermediate knowledge of Microsoft Office Suite applications.The ability to communicate in French is considered an asset.Working Conditions:May be required to work overtime.We also consider your potential.If you know you have what it takes to do the job, but your experience doesn’t exactly match the qualifications above, we encourage you to apply and provide us with more details about why you think you would be a great fit.Additional InformationSome of the Perks We Offer:We offer best-in-class pension and benefits, total reward programs and comprehensive mental wellness supports to set you up for every success in and outside of work.
